01. Context
Fourth is an experimental visual art game. The work is the loop, the look, and the pitch as one object. It is a world to walk — a fortress in the middle of nowhere.
02. My Work
This is a solo project. I designed a walkable world. The visual experimentation was the main point of this work. I worked with a particle system that is responsive with the camera and aimed to create stunningly beautiful particles moving around the space as you walked in this ghostly transparent fortress.
Special note: I participated in A MAZE. 2026 with this project.
